
Operation Charlotte Corday was a failed OAS assassination attempt on President of France Charles de Gaulle that occurred on 22 August 1962. Jean Bastien-Thiry signalled for three OAS members to rake De Gaulle's car with machine gun fire in the Paris suburb of Petit-Clamart, and one bullet barely missed De Gaulle's head. The failed assassination attempt led to Bastien-Thiry's execution and the arrest of several other members of the plot.
